In many places, the amount that can grow is limited by available water, not sunlight. This means that adding solar panels above some, but not all, of the field lets you make significant use of that excess sunlight, increasing overall crop yield.
Not to mention that the added shade will help with moisture retention, which is another part of the reason why it is possible to increase crop yield when adding solar to a field.
